Re: additional triggers changing sampling rate from 2048 Hz to 256 Hz
ActiView does not allow you to change the sample rate while saving data to file (decimation selector is grayed out while saving). Any unexpected triggers seen in EEGLAB (that reads the BDF file) must have another explanation.

Re: additional triggers changing sampling rate from 2048 Hz to 256 Hz
When decimating from 2048 to 256 Hz, an OR function is applied to trigger bits within each group of 8 original samples. A repetition of very short (millisecond) triggers can therefore appear as a single trigger in the decimated file. So, no triggers are missed (provided positive trigger logic is used) and no extra triggers are generated.
As always: use the "analog'' trigger display mode to inspect unexpected triggers
